val map : ('b, 'cmp, ('a, _) set -> f:('a -> 'b elt) -> ('b, 'cmp) t) create_options

The types of map and filter_map are subtle. The input set, ('a, _) set, reflects the fact that these functions take a set of *any* type, with any comparator, while the output set, ('b, 'cmp) t, reflects that the output set has the particular 'cmp of the creation function. The comparator can come in one of three ways, depending on which set module is used

  • Set.map -- comparator comes as an argument
  • Set.Poly.map -- comparator is polymorphic comparison
  • Foo.Set.map -- comparator is Foo.comparator
